Chef’s comment This series of events features champagne from a different house each time. When thinking about a menu, we first research the brand’s history, terroir, and flavor characteristics, and look for hints that can be applied to the dishes. From there, we create dishes by combining ingredients that go well together. The selection of ingredients is also an important point, with some of the vegetables being ordered from specific farmers in Ishikawa Prefecture, and selected with particular attention to taste and quality. https://prcdn.freetls.fastly.net/release_image/5113/3574/5113-3574-8920e8da61e86b64778584737b7f2eb5-3900×2596.jpg Since its founding in 1743, the Champagne Maison Moët & Chandon, which continues to be loved all over the world, has enchanted people by accompanying them to celebrations and life’s unforgettable moments. Moët & Chandon was the official wine of the French court at the time of King Louis XV, and Madame de Pompadour declared, “Champagne is the only thing that makes a woman more beautiful after drinking it.” In addition, Emperor Alexander I of Russia and King Charles X of France favored the Maison, and in particular there was a deep friendship between Napoleon I and the then head of the family, Jean Remy Moët, and the Maison’s representative champagne, Moët Impérial, was named “Imperial” in honor of Napoleon I. Moët & Chandon has the largest acreage in the Champagne region, and has inherited the savoir-faire (artisan craftsmanship) perfected by successive generations of winemakers over the three centuries since its founding in 1743, leveraging its high-quality grapes, long-cultivated champagne-making know-how, and modern equipment. In addition, we are working to protect the biodiversity of the Champagne region through our sustainability program Natura Nostra, and since 2009 we have also been running our philanthropic program Toast for a Cause.
